Skip to content
Home » Mongoose Create Collection? Top 7 Best Answers

Mongoose Create Collection? Top 7 Best Answers

Are you looking for an answer to the topic “mongoose create collection“? We answer all your questions at the website Budget-template.com in category: Latest technology and computer news updates for you. You will find the answer right below.

Keep Reading

Mongoose Create Collection
Mongoose Create Collection

Table of Contents

Does Mongoose model create a collection?

Mongoose never create any collection until you will save/create any document.

What is collection in Mongoose?

It defines a strongly-typed-schema, with default values and schema validations which are later mapped to a MongoDB document. For creating a collection with Mongoose you have to create two necessary things: Schema: It is a document structure that contains the property with its types ( default value, validations, etc.


Mongoose Crash Course – Beginner Through Advanced

Mongoose Crash Course – Beginner Through Advanced
Mongoose Crash Course – Beginner Through Advanced

Images related to the topicMongoose Crash Course – Beginner Through Advanced

Mongoose Crash Course - Beginner Through Advanced
Mongoose Crash Course – Beginner Through Advanced

How do I create a collection schema in MongoDB?

Create collection in mongodb compass

Open the Mongodb compass and paste the below connection string to connect to mongodb. Click on create a database to create a new database. Click on create a database to create the naive database and testnaive collection.

See also  10 important Computer Tricks Every Computer User Must Know technology gyan computer

What is create in Mongoose?

Mongoose models have a create() function that is often used to create new documents. const User = mongoose.model(‘User’, mongoose.Schema({ email: String })); const doc = await User.create({ email: ‘[email protected]’ }); doc instanceof User; // true doc.email; // ‘[email protected]

Is MongoDB faster than Mongoose?

Mongoose is built untop of mongodb driver, the mongodb driver is more low level. Mongoose provides that easy abstraction to easily define a schema and query. But on the perfomance side Mongdb Driver is best.

What is a collection in MongoDB?

A collection is a grouping of MongoDB documents. Documents within a collection can have different fields. A collection is the equivalent of a table in a relational database system.

Should I use Mongoose or MongoDB?

Mongoose is not the only ODM library, there are hapijs/joi, MongoDB schemas, etc. And while Mongoose is good especially in areas of inferring data types, we should choose to use the MongoDB schema validation for schemas validation.


See some more details on the topic mongoose create collection here:


Mongoose doesn’t create new collection – node.js – Stack …

The reason is, mongoose only auto-creates collections on startup that have indexes in them. Your User collection has a unique index in it, …

+ Read More Here

How to make Mongoose multiple collections using Node.js

Create data objects, you want to insert, for all the collection then insert as shown in main.js file. As soon as we will insert data our …

+ View Here

Express Tutorial Part 3: Using a Database (with Mongoose)

Enter a username and password. Remember to copy and store the credentials safely as we will need them later on. Click the Create User button.

+ Read More Here

db.createCollection() — MongoDB Manual

Because MongoDB creates a collection implicitly when the collection is first referenced in a command, this method is used primarily for creating new …

+ View Here

What is schema in Mongoose?

A Mongoose schema defines the structure of the document, default values, validators, etc., whereas a Mongoose model provides an interface to the database for creating, querying, updating, deleting records, etc.

How do I join a specific collection in MongoDB?

Go to MongoDB website, Login > Connect > Connect Application > Copy > Paste in ‘database_url’ > Collections > Copy/Paste in ‘collection’ .

How do you create a collection and insert data in MongoDB?

To insert a single document using MongoDB Compass:
  1. Navigate to the collection you wish to insert the document into: …
  2. Click the Insert Document button: …
  3. For each field in the document, select the field type and fill in the field name and value. …
  4. Once all fields have been filled out, click Insert.

What is the command used to create a collection inside a database?

For example, you use db. createCollection() to create a capped collection, or to create a new collection that uses document validation. db. createCollection() is a wrapper around the database command create .

See also  Mongodb Compare String Date? Trust The Answer

How do I show collections in MongoDB?

connect with the MongoDB database using mongo . This will start the connection. then run show dbs command. This will show you all exiting/available databases.

List all collections from the mongo shell:
  1. db. getCollectionNames()
  2. show collections.
  3. show tables.

How does Mongoose fetch data?

How to Fetch Data From mongodb in Node js and Display in HTML (ejs)
  1. Step 1 – Create Node Express js App.
  2. Step 2 – Install express flash ejs body-parser mongoose dependencies.
  3. Step 3 – Connect App to MongoDB.
  4. Step 4 – Create Model.
  5. Step 5 – Create Routes.
  6. Step 6 – Create HTML Table and Display List.

🔴 #2: Mongoose Schema and Models Explained | Create Collections using Mongoose in Hindi in 2020

🔴 #2: Mongoose Schema and Models Explained | Create Collections using Mongoose in Hindi in 2020
🔴 #2: Mongoose Schema and Models Explained | Create Collections using Mongoose in Hindi in 2020

Images related to the topic🔴 #2: Mongoose Schema and Models Explained | Create Collections using Mongoose in Hindi in 2020

🔴 #2: Mongoose Schema And Models Explained | Create Collections Using Mongoose In Hindi In 2020
🔴 #2: Mongoose Schema And Models Explained | Create Collections Using Mongoose In Hindi In 2020

Why do we use Mongoose?

Mongoose is a Node. js-based Object Data Modeling (ODM) library for MongoDB. It is akin to an Object Relational Mapper (ORM) such as SQLAlchemy for traditional SQL databases. The problem that Mongoose aims to solve is allowing developers to enforce a specific schema at the application layer.

Is Mongoose A ORM?

Mongoose is similar to an ORM (Object-Relational Mapper) you would use with a relational database. Both ODMs and ORMs can make your life easier with built-in structure and methods. The structure of an ODM or ORM will contain business logic that helps you organize data.

Is mongoose used in industry?

The companies using Mongoose Metrics are most often found in United States and in the Construction industry. Mongoose Metrics is most often used by companies with 10-50 employees and 1M-10M dollars in revenue.

What is ODM database?

ODM is Object Document Mapping. It is like an ORM for non-relational databases or distributed databases such as MongoDB, i.e., mapping an object model and NoSQL database (document databases, graph database, etc.).

What does BSON stand for?

BSON stands for Binary Javascript Object Notation. It is a binary-encoded serialization of JSON documents. BSON has been extended to add some optional non-JSON-native data types, like dates and binary data.

Is collection and table same?

A collection is analogous to a table of an RDBMS. A collection may store documents those who are not same in structure. This is possible because MongoDB is a Schema-free database. In a relational database like MySQL, a schema defines the organization / structure of data in a database.

See also  Mongodb Count Rows? All Answers

What is the difference between database and collection in MongoDB?

Databases, collections, documents are important parts of MongoDB without them you are not able to store data on the MongoDB server. A Database contains a collection, and a collection contains documents and the documents contain data, they are related to each other.

How many collections can be created in MongoDB?

In general, try to limit your replica set to 10,000 collections.

Why is mongoose popular for MongoDB?

Mongoose provides optional pre and post save operations for data models. This makes it easy to define hooks and custom functionality on successful reads/writes etc. You can also define custom methods that act on a particular instance (or document).

Which database is best for Node JS?

Node. js supports all kinds of databases no matter if it is a relational database or NoSQL database. However, NoSQL databases like MongoDb are the best fit with Node. js.

What is collection name?

The collection name is the value that is associated with the CollectionName attribute in the message collection tree structure. Each message collection has only one name.


02 – Create a Model – MongoDB and Mongoose – freeCodeCamp Tutorial

02 – Create a Model – MongoDB and Mongoose – freeCodeCamp Tutorial
02 – Create a Model – MongoDB and Mongoose – freeCodeCamp Tutorial

Images related to the topic02 – Create a Model – MongoDB and Mongoose – freeCodeCamp Tutorial

02 - Create A Model - Mongodb And Mongoose - Freecodecamp Tutorial
02 – Create A Model – Mongodb And Mongoose – Freecodecamp Tutorial

How do I search in MongoDB?

Find() Method. In MongoDB, find() method is used to select documents in a collection and return a cursor to the selected documents. Cursor means a pointer that points to a document, when we use find() method it returns a pointer on the selected documents and returns one by one.

How do I access mongoose?

You can connect to MongoDB with the mongoose. connect() method. mongoose. connect(‘mongodb://localhost:27017/myapp’);

Related searches to mongoose create collection

  • mongoose create new collection
  • mongoose auto create collection
  • mongoose connect
  • mongoose create empty collection
  • mongoose update
  • mongoose create collection dynamically
  • mongoose create vs save
  • mongoose insert
  • mongodb mongoose create collection
  • mongoose github
  • how does mongoose create collection
  • mongoose does not create collection
  • mongoose schema create collection
  • mongoose create collection if not exists
  • mongoose model
  • how to create collection in mongodb using mongoose
  • mongoose save
  • mongoose create collection on start
  • mongoose create collection with schema
  • mongoose create schema from existing collection
  • node js mongoose create collection
  • mongoose mongodb create collection

Information related to the topic mongoose create collection

Here are the search results of the thread mongoose create collection from Bing. You can read more if you want.


You have just come across an article on the topic mongoose create collection. If you found this article useful, please share it. Thank you very much.

Leave a Reply

Your email address will not be published.